Mark Salinas

Training And Development Manager at GULF STREAM MARINE

Mark Salinas has over three decades of experience in the maritime and terminal management sectors. Currently serving as the Training and Development Manager at Gulf Stream Marine since September 2001, Salinas has also held the positions of General Manager and General Superintendent within the same company. Prior to this, Salinas was the Terminal Manager/Superintendent at Ceres Marine Terminal and the General Director at Ceres Ukraine. Earlier career roles include General Superintendent at Fairway Terminals and a military career with the US Marine Corps, where Salinas attained the rank of Captain and served in various capacities, including Infantry Officer and Artillery Officer. Mark Salinas hol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Marine Transportation from the United States Merchant Marine Academy.
